bluetooth avec java

bluetooth avec java - Java - Programmation

Marsh Posté le 03-04-2006 à 15:47:46    

Bonjour à tous !
voilà j'essaye de développer une application java qui fait du bluetooth sur un ipaq avec winCE. Mais mon appli bloque  :??: dès le début sur:
 
try{
   
    Localdevice localDevice = LocalDevice.getLocalDevice();
      }
  catch(BluetoothStateException e){
   System.err.println("probleme" );}[/#38ff00] :??:  
 
Il rentre dans l'exception et n'arrive même pas à faire un getlocaldevice().
Le bluetooth est bien activé et j'utilise la stack d'Avetana. Il n'y a aucune erreur à la compilation.
Merci mille fois de votre aide bien précieuse. :love:  


---------------
eh oui y'a des filles qui font de l'info
Reply

Marsh Posté le 03-04-2006 à 15:47:46   

Reply

Marsh Posté le 03-04-2006 à 16:52:03    

Dans le catch, e.printStackTrace() et tu auras le message d'erreur.
Si tu utilises la version d'essai, tu as bien l'adresse de ton equipement bluetooth ?

Reply

Marsh Posté le 04-04-2006 à 09:25:43    

merci !
il me dit : "Include the certificate.crp in the classpath"
mais ce "certificate.crp" il est fourni avec une autre stack bluetooth qui est avelinkBT.
J'ai donc changé la stack et mis ce fichier dans le classpath mais ça ne change rien, j'ai toujours le même message d'erreur...:-(
merci de votre aide


---------------
eh oui y'a des filles qui font de l'info
Reply

Marsh Posté le 04-04-2006 à 10:22:51    

Si tu utilises avetana, enleve toutes les autres librairies bluetooth du classpath.
Lorsque tu compiles ton application, ton classpath ne doit contenir que avetanaBluetooth.jar pour le bluetooth.

Reply

Marsh Posté le 04-04-2006 à 11:30:02    

en fait je travaille avec wsdd (tu connait surement c'est un ide).
je rajoute avetana dans "add external jar" mais si je mets rien d'autre dans le classpath il me dit qu'il manque Certificate.crp. Et si je rajoute manuellement certificate.crp dans le classpath dans le raccourci de lancement, il me met la même erreur.
 
voici le raccourci qui lance mon application :  
 
93#"\carte\SDDISK\JVM\J9\bin\j9.exe" "-classpath" "\carte\AppliPDA.jxe" "-jcl:ppro10" "AppliPDA"
 
Je présume que le fichier jxe contient mon avetana.jar. c'est la que je rajoute certificat.crp mais j'ai toujours la même erreur
 
 


---------------
eh oui y'a des filles qui font de l'info
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ed